PBFX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2014 in Review

48 of the 3,765 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in PBF LOGISTICS LP (PBFX) for Q4 2014, worth a combined $282M — down 13% from $325M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 14 funds opened new PBFX positions and 10 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 15 added to existing stakes and 15 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Goldman Sachs, adding an estimated $14.8M. The largest seller was Deutsche Bank, exiting entirely with an estimated $7.24M sold.
